Income is the money (annual earnings) that you make at your job, while wealth is what you own. Wealth is your net worth that includes the value of all of your assets minus your financial liabilities.

Income is the flow of money that comes into a household from employers, owning a business, state benefits, rents on properties, and so on. Wealth essentially represents people's savings and it's typically higher – and spread out more unevenly – than income.
